发明名称 Downlink transmission coordinated scheduling
摘要 A method of coordinated scheduling of a downlink transmission flow from a first radio network node to a user equipment UE in a second radio network node. The method includes scheduling the downlink transmission flow so that the in-sequence delivery of the received data blocks can be kept in an acceptable level in the UE by adjusting a scheduling priority of the downlink transmission flow in the second radio network node. The method may further include estimating one or more buffer-related parameters based on buffered data for the downlink transmission flow from the first radio network node, and determining, based on the estimated one or more buffer-related parameter and/or one or more parameters associated with the operation status of the second radio network node, if the in-sequence delivery of the received data blocks to higher layers can be in an acceptable level in the UE.

主权项 1. A method of coordinated scheduling of a downlink transmission flow from a first radio network node to a user equipment UE in a second radio network node, the method comprising steps of: scheduling the downlink transmission flow so that in-sequence delivery of received data blocks can be kept in an acceptable level in the UE by adjusting a scheduling priority of the downlink transmission flow in the second radio network node; determining, based on one or more buffer-related parameters, that in-sequence delivery of data blocks to higher layers in the UE can reach an acceptable level even without adjusting scheduling priority of the downlink transmission flow in the second radio network node, or that there may be out-of-sequence delivery of received data blocks to the higher layers in the UE with adjusting the scheduling priority of the downlink transmission flow in the second radio network node; and resetting the scheduling priority of the downlink transmission flow to an original scheduling priority in the second radio network node, or recalculating the scheduling priority of the downlink transmission flow without considering the scheduling priority adjustment.
